JOB DESCRIPTION:
Responsible for assuring Care Coordination and Support (CCS) services are provided in compliance with the Pathways to Success Care Coordination and support organization requirements. Works collaboratively with other service teams to meet the needs of clients assigned via Pathways. Responsible for monitoring effectiveness of services as well as assists with community based child and family team meetings, IMCANS review, crisis prevention and safety planning.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
Provides regular supervision and monthly development to Care Coordinators.Assures accurate, complete, and timely submission of required documentation and reports per agency policy and/or funding/contract requirements. Provides ongoing case management services for assigned service recipients, including but not limited to assessment, planning, linking, monitoring, referral and advocacy.Presents relevant information for the purpose of assuring quality of care, gaining feedback, and planning changes in provision of personal growth-based services. Identifies and reports all Critical Incidents according to Centerstone policy. Ensures compliance with service contracts, subcontracts, accreditation standards, funding agency expectations, and Corporation policies and procedures.Provides community education as assigned.K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S & ABILITIES
Effectively communicate via written, verbal, in person and virtual methods.
Skill in customer service/experience techniques.Knowledge of role and function of various community resources.Skill in problem-solving.Knowledge of basic service recipient’s dynamics of assigned disability groups.QUALIFICATIONS
Education Level
Master’s degree in human service related field.
Years of Experience
Three years of behavioral health experience.
Supervisory experience preferred.
